GUESS MY JOB!

Students will practice using modal verbs (have to, don’t have to, must, mustn’t) while guessing different jobs.

Instructions:
  1. Pair up with a partner. One student thinks of a job and describes it using only modal verbs (have to, don’t have to, must, mustn’t), without revealing the job title.
  2. The partner must guess the job within a time limit (e.g., 1 minute).
  3. If the partner guesses correctly, they earn 1 point.
  4. After each round, switch roles.

Then create descriptions for the following jobs and play with a partner: actor, entrepreneur, accountant, vet, programmer, window washer, fashion stylist, poker player, bartender, drummer in a rock band
